Material:
The choice of material directly affects glove performance in a first aid context. Nitrile gloves offer a good balance of durability and flexibility. They resist chemicals and punctures, making them suitable for handling various substances. Latex gloves have excellent elasticity and tactile feel. However, they pose a risk for individuals with latex allergies. Vinyl gloves are a looser fit, useful for tasks where exact fit and dexterity are less critical. According to a 2015 study published by the Journal of Clinical Medicine, nitrile gloves are recommended for healthcare settings to minimize allergy risks.
Size:
Size matters for comfort and effectiveness. Gloves that fit properly enhance grip and allow for more precise movements. Common sizes include small, medium, large, and extra-large. Studies show that ill-fitting gloves can lead to reduced dexterity, which is crucial in a first aid scenario. The CDC highlights that proper glove size improves user compliance and safety during medical procedures.
Durability:
Durability is crucial for gloves in a first aid kit. Puncture-resistant gloves prevent risk during medical emergencies. Tear-resistant materials ensure that gloves do not break during use, which can expose the user to hazards. For instance, the American Journal of Infection Control emphasizes the importance of high-standards materials to mitigate infection risks.
Latex Sensitivity:
Latex sensitivity is an important factor. Many individuals are allergic to latex proteins, leading to severe reactions. The availability of latex-free options, such as nitrile and vinyl gloves, provides solutions to this problem. The Allergy and Asthma Foundation reports that approximately 3-6% of healthcare workers are affected by latex allergies, urging the importance of non-latex gloves in first aid kits.
Ease of Use:
Ease of use can significantly impact the effectiveness of gloves during emergencies. Textured grips can prevent slippage, especially in wet conditions. The debate over powdered versus powdered-free gloves also exists. Powdered gloves allow for easier donning, but powder can cause irritation or contamination. A review in the Journal of Hospital Infection suggests powdered-free gloves are preferable for infection control.
Storage:
Storage options for gloves are essential to maintain their integrity. Resealable packaging helps protect against contamination and moisture. Moreover, checking the shelf life ensures gloves remain effective and safe. The FDA suggests regular inspections of personal protective equipment, including gloves, to ensure they meet safety standards, especially for emergencies.
What Types of Gloves Are the Best for First Aid Kits?
The best types of gloves for first aid kits are nitrile, latex, and vinyl gloves.
- Nitrile gloves
- Latex gloves
- Vinyl gloves
To understand why these types of gloves are preferred, we can look at the unique attributes of each option.
-
Nitrile Gloves: Nitrile gloves are made from synthetic rubber. These gloves are puncture-resistant and provide excellent protection against bloodborne pathogens. According to the CDC, they are ideal for individuals with latex allergies. Nitrile gloves also offer a snug fit, which enhances dexterity. A study by the University of Florida in 2016 found that nitrile gloves effectively resist chemicals compared to latex or vinyl.
-
Latex Gloves: Latex gloves are traditional medical gloves made from natural rubber. They are known for their elasticity and comfort, which allows for prolonged use. However, some people have latex allergies, making these gloves less suitable for universal use. A source from the American Medical Association highlights that while latex gloves can provide good barrier protection, further studies show an increasing need for alternatives due to allergy concerns.
-
Vinyl Gloves: Vinyl gloves are made from polyvinyl chloride (PVC). They are a cost-effective option for low-risk tasks in first aid. However, they provide less protection against chemicals and are more prone to tearing compared to nitrile or latex gloves. The FDA categorizes vinyl gloves as suitable for non-hazardous tasks; thus, their use should be limited to low-risk environments. A 2018 study published in the Journal of Occupational Health indicates that vinyl gloves should be used when non-hazardous applications are anticipated.

When Should You Choose Vinyl Gloves for First Aid Applications?
You should choose vinyl gloves for first aid applications when you need a cost-effective option that provides a basic level of protection. Vinyl gloves are a suitable choice in situations involving minor injuries without exposure to blood or bodily fluids. They work well in clean environments, such as administering first aid in a home or office. Additionally, vinyl gloves are latex-free, making them ideal for individuals with latex allergies. Choose these gloves when speed is essential since they can be put on and taken off quickly. However, avoid using vinyl gloves in scenarios that require durability or chemical resistance, such as handling hazardous materials or dealing with severe injuries.

Why Are Nitrile Gloves Considered Superior for First Aid Use?
Nitrile gloves are considered superior for first aid use due to their strong barrier protection, comfort, and resistance to various chemicals and pathogens. These gloves provide excellent dexterity, which is essential for performing intricate first aid tasks.
According to the U.S. Occupational Safety and Health Administration (OSHA), nitrile gloves are highly effective in protecting against bloodborne pathogens and other hazardous materials. Their use helps minimize the risk of contamination for both the responder and the patient.
Nitrile gloves are made from a synthetic rubber that offers several advantages. First, they provide a better fit compared to latex gloves, making it easier to handle small tools or perform delicate procedures. Second, they are resistant to punctures, which reduces the likelihood of breakage during use. Lastly, they do not contain latex, preventing allergic reactions in sensitive individuals.
Nitrile is a synthetic compound created from acrylonitrile and butadiene. This combination results in a material that is flexible, durable, and resistant to tears. The manufacturing process involves polymerizing these compounds to form a robust glove suitable for medical use.
Specific conditions enhance the effectiveness of nitrile gloves in first aid. For instance, when treating wounds, their chemical resistance ensures that disinfectants and other solutions do not break down the glove material. Moreover, scenarios such as cleaning up bodily fluids or handling sharp objects accentuate the importance of using nitrile gloves over alternatives like vinyl or latex, which may offer less protection.
In summary, nitrile gloves’ combination of strength, comfort, and compatibility with various substances makes them the ideal choice for first aid situations.

In What Situations Should Gloves Be Worn During First Aid?
Gloves should be worn during first aid in several situations. First, wear gloves when you come into contact with blood. Blood can carry infections. Second, use gloves when treating open wounds. This protects both the injured person and the caregiver from infections. Third, wear gloves when handling any bodily fluids, such as saliva or vomit. These fluids may also contain pathogens. Fourth, use gloves when giving mouth-to-mouth resuscitation. This minimizes the risk of transmission of diseases. Lastly, gloves should be worn when treating a person with a known infection. This reduces the risk of spreading the infection to others. Always dispose of gloves properly after use to maintain hygiene.
